You know it's going to be a good day when you wake up, check your email, and see a "Thank You" message from Radiohead with two new, free tracks available for download. According to the email, this is not some new type of rewards system, just an "old-fashioned thank you" for supporting the band and buying their music.
"Supercollider," the first track, was started during the
King of Limbs sessions and was finished in March. They didn't skimp on this one either -- it's a whopping 7 minutes long.
"The Butcher" was recorded and mixed at the same time as their album, but they "couldn't make it work." So here they are - "Supercollider" is the first streaming track on this post, and you can find "The Butcher" below. Enjoy, and if you bought
